This commit is contained in:
2026-01-22 14:50:58 -07:00
parent 4256c147c5
commit 92800f0b96

View File

@@ -8,6 +8,7 @@ export default function CaptchaCodePage () {
const [token, setToken] = useState<string | null>(null) const [token, setToken] = useState<string | null>(null)
const [code, setCode] = useState<string | null>(null) const [code, setCode] = useState<string | null>(null)
const [result, setResult] = useState<number>(-1) const [result, setResult] = useState<number>(-1)
const [resultMsg, setResultMsg] = useState<string | null>(null)
const [showCopied, setShowCopied] = useState<boolean>(false) const [showCopied, setShowCopied] = useState<boolean>(false)
return ( return (
@@ -27,9 +28,13 @@ export default function CaptchaCodePage () {
if (result.data.success) { if (result.data.success) {
setCode(result.data.data) setCode(result.data.data)
setResult(2) setResult(2)
} else {
if (result.data.message) {
setResultMsg(result.data.message)
} else { } else {
setResult(3) setResult(3)
} }
}
} catch { } catch {
setResult(3) setResult(3)
} }
@@ -44,7 +49,8 @@ export default function CaptchaCodePage () {
? 'Unable to verify captcha, please reload page.' ? 'Unable to verify captcha, please reload page.'
: result == 2 : result == 2
? 'Here is your verification code. It will in 10 minutes or when used.' ? 'Here is your verification code. It will in 10 minutes or when used.'
: 'Failed to get verification code. Please try again later.'} : resultMsg ??
'Failed to get verification code. Please try again later.'}
</p> </p>
<p <p
className='bg-[rgb(64,64,88)] border border-[rgb(88,88,112)] hover:bg-[rgb(88,88,112)] hover:border-[rgb(112,112,136)] rounded-md px-2 py-1 mt-4 transition-colors text-center cursor-pointer' className='bg-[rgb(64,64,88)] border border-[rgb(88,88,112)] hover:bg-[rgb(88,88,112)] hover:border-[rgb(112,112,136)] rounded-md px-2 py-1 mt-4 transition-colors text-center cursor-pointer'